The Role
The Demand Planner will own the 12-month global demand forecast, creating a credible view of future demand that underpins supply, capacity and financial decision-making.

Key responsibilities include:
  • Own the rolling 12-month global demand forecast, providing a single, credible view of future demand
  • Consolidate and challenge commercial, marketing and historical data to produce insight-led forecasts
  • Act as the single source of truth for demand, clearly communicating changes, risks and assumptions
  • Provide structured, high-quality inputs into S&OP, highlighting volatility and step changes
  • Track forecast accuracy and bias, identifying root causes and driving continuous improvement
  • Partner cross-functionally with Sales, Marketing and Finance to support informed decision-making
